Latest Patents

Lutze's most recent patents reflect his deep understanding of chemical separations and energy integration. One of his notable inventions is an "Energy-efficient process for removing butenes from C4-hydrocarbon streams." This process leverages extractive distillation with a suitable solvent and incorporates heat integration, allowing the utilization of heat from the solvent to efficiently heat or partially evaporate various streams.

Another significant patent is a "Method for separating butenes from C4 hydrocarbon streams, with subsequent oligomerisation." Similar to his first patent, this method also uses extractive distillation with a suitable solvent, followed by an adiabatic oligomerisation. The innovative aspect of this method lies in its heat integration, which further optimizes energy use and boosts efficiency.
